Strathclyde 16 Year Old 2005 (cask 15407) - Old Particular (Douglas Laing)

Single grain from the Strathclyde Distillery, independently bottled up by Douglas Laing for the wonderful Old Particular range. This one was aged in a single barrel for 16 years, from November 2005 to November 2021. Following that, this glorious grain was bottled at 48.4% ABV, with just 160 of these bottles produced.

Tasting Note by The Chaps at Master of Malt

Nose

Orange boiled sweets, some tangy red fruit, and polished oak.

Palate

Intensely creamy, with loads of vanilla and honey. A hint of new leather appears underneath.

Finish

Grapefruit, toasted brown sugar, and anise.
